Filming underway in Ireland on Virgin Media Television and ITV's new drama series Redemption
13 Apr 2021 : Nathan Griffin
Filming set to get underway
Co-commissioned by Virgin Media Television and ITV, in association with Fís Éireann/Screen Ireland, Redemption will start filming today in Ireland and sees Paula Malcomson (The Hunger Games movies, The Green Mile) take the lead role as DI Colette Cunningham.

Created by Sean Cook (The Last Ship, The Code, Holby City) and executive produced by Tall Story Pictures’ creative director Catherine Oldfield (The Bay, Sticks and Stones, Trauma) and executive producer Patrick Schweitzer (Bancroft, Save Me, SSGB), the drama introduces plain speaking, no nonsense DI Colette Cunningham, whose fearless approach to policing has earned her the respect of her Merseyside Police Serious Crime Squad colleagues.

The six part series will be produced by leading independent production company, Tall Story Pictures, part of ITV Studios and producers of successful returning ITV drama The Bay. The project is being co-produced by Metropolitan Films, one of Ireland’s leading film and television production companies.

Redemption has been commissioned for ITV by Head of Drama Polly Hill and Commissioning Editor, Huw Kennair Jones. Huw will oversee production of the drama from the channel’s perspective. The drama has been jointly commissioned by Virgin Media Television in Ireland’s Content Director Bill Malone. 

The series will be produced by John Wallace (Rialto, End of Sentence, Cellar Door) and directed by John Hayes (Dublin Murders, Bancroft) with investment from Screen Ireland. The series producer is Ingrid Goodwin. Joining the writing team, alongside Sean Cook, are Noel Farragher (Law & Order: UK, The Frankenstein Chronicles) and Susan E Connolly.

Speaking about the announcement, James Flynn of Metropolitan Films said: “We are proud to have facilitated the production of this powerful television drama in Ireland, and to partner with Tall Stories Pictures and with the broadcasters and funders backing the project, including the Irish Government’s Section 481 production investment tax incentive”.

Acclaimed Irish actress Paula Malcomson (The Hunger Games trilogy, Ray Donovan, Deadwood) will take the lead role alongside other key Irish cast including Moe Dumford (Vikings), Siobhan McSweeney (Derry Girls), Keith McErlean (Black ’47 and Sing Street), Thaddea Graham (The Letter for the King and The Irregulars), and Ian Lloyd Anderson (Blood S2 and Love/Hate).

Catherine Oldfield and Patrick Schweitzer, from Tall Story Pictures added: “Redemption is a wonderfully emotional story about one woman trying to come to terms with the mistakes of the past and also about second chances.  In Colette, Sean has created a richly-drawn heroine who we can’t wait to bring to the screen.”

Career driven and dedicated, Colette is unflappable and an absolute force of nature. Until she takes a call from Garda Sergeant Luke Byrne from the Gardaí in Dublin.  The body of a young woman has been found and Colette is listed as the next of kin.

The name of the victim means nothing to Colette so she continues to efficiently go about her day job. Persisting with his enquiry, the young officer calls again and begins to describe the young woman rendering Colette speechless. She takes the next ferry to Dublin to identify the body of her missing daughter, Kate. 

She’s experienced this exact situation a million times, but never from this side. Kate left home 20 years ago, aged 16, and clearly didn’t want to be found. Always a police woman and with 30 years of experience kicking in, Colette has some searching questions.

With her life turned upside down, and grief consuming her every thought, Colette resolves to stay in Ireland to work for the Garda.  But what will she unearth about the events leading up to Kate’s death, and the life that her daughter chose to build for herself?  Consumed by feelings she may have failed Kate in life, Colette is determined to do right by her now.

“Supporting and developing Irish content with global ambition has been a key pillar of VMTV’s strategy and we are delighted to partner with ITV for what promises to be a thrilling new Irish drama in Redemption,” said Bill Malone, Director of Content, Virgin Media Television. “The quality of the scripts had me gripped from the off and I can’t wait to see it on screen.”
